Fulfude and Kirdi people living in the Northern region, as well as Bamileke-Bamoun and Grassfielders ethnic groups' tradition forbade out-of-wedlock childbearing which caused dishonor for family and was sanctioned heavily by communities. The central premise of the Hague Convention on the Civil Aspects of International Child Abduction is that childrens interests are best served when custody decisions are made in the childs country of habitual residence. According to the Supreme Courts recent decision in Monasky v. Taglieri, 140 S. Ct. 719 (2020), a childs habitual residence depends on the particular circumstances of each case and does not turn on the existence of an actual agreement between the parents on where to raise their child. Normative early marriage, rigorous supervision of young women, polygamy and strong negative sanctions in the case of infraction were social strategies to avoid premarital sex and its consequences. WebIn most situations, you can file for custody in the home state of the child. One or both parents may want primary custody or have different ideas about whats best for their children. In Kulko v. Superior Court of Cal., 436 U.S. 84 (1978), the U.S. Supreme Court interpreted the due process clause to afford parents and partners living outside the forum state substantial protection from state court jurisdiction, even if their children live in the forum state with their permission. In some cases, American courts will afford practical recognition to foreign divorce decrees even if neither spouse was domiciled in the foreign country as long as both had notice of the proceeding and appeared before the foreign court or acquiesced to its jurisdiction. Cases in which courts deny visitation rights often include noncustodial parents who had physically or emotionally abused the child in the past and noncustodial parents severely suffering from a mental illness that would emotionally devastate the child.
